Malware Insights
The PDF file exhibits characteristics of malicious intent, including obfuscated JavaScript and XFA form elements, as indicated by the ClamAV detection 'Heuristics.PDF.ObfuscatedNameObject'. The presence of embedded JavaScript suggests an attempt to execute code upon opening the document. While the specific payload is not immediately clear from the static analysis, the techniques employed are commonly used for delivering malware or phishing lures. The embedded URLs, though not definitively malicious, are associated with the document's structure.
